Output ac5627ea5b39f9a8ccfc17b13a68fd5e24082ffda3f88dd5f1320bfbec9ab6c4:25

value
2230086
script pubkey
OP_0 OP_PUSHBYTES_20 b1ae341c794498c4c4912682c77c46a0dce4c5b1
address
ltc1qkxhrg8regjvvf3y3y6pvwlzx5rwwf3d3q56tqq
transaction
ac5627ea5b39f9a8ccfc17b13a68fd5e24082ffda3f88dd5f1320bfbec9ab6c4
spent
true